High-status Roman villa found in England

Tuesday, August 19, 2008 - 16:28 in Paleontology & Archaeology

BRADING, England, Aug. 19 (UPI) -- A Roman historical site on the Isle of Wight in Britain, dismissed by Victorian-era excavators as a barn, has turned out to be a large Roman villa.
